Dr. Chellappa joins Frye Regional’s growing team
Board-certified in pulmonary medicine and internal medicine and board-eligible in critical care medicine, Dr. Chellappa provides comprehensive care for adults and seniors. She treats a wide range of pulmonary diseases, including COPD, asthma and interstitial lung diseases. Dr. Chellappa is skilled in diagnosing lung cancer using advanced bronchoscopic procedures such as navigational bronchoscopy, endobronchial ultrasound and transbronchial cryobiopsy. She also manages critical care cases, including shock, respiratory failure and post-cardiac arrest recovery. Fluent in English, Tamil, Hindi and Telugu, Dr. Chellappa offers both in-person and telehealth visits.
“Patients and their families are at the center of everything I do,” said Dr. Chellappa. “I strive to empower them with the best medical advice so we can make decisions together for stronger, healthier outcomes.”
Dr. Chellappa earned her medical degree from Sri Ramachandra Medical College and Research Institute in Chennai, India. She completed her internal medicine residency at Trinity Health Ann Arbor Hospital in Ypsilanti, Michigan, where she also served as chief resident. She then pursued fellowship training in pulmonary and critical care medicine at Jefferson Einstein Philadelphia Hospital in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.
Her professional honors include the best intern award during residency and recognition for leadership as chief resident. She is a member of the American College of Physicians, American College of Chest Physicians and American Thoracic Society.
Dr. Nepal expands access to pulmonary care
Board-certified in pulmonary medicine, internal medicine and critical care medicine, Dr. Nepal spec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of pulmonary diseases, including asthma, sleep apnea, emphysema, chronic bronchitis/COPD, lung tumors and lung cancer. He also has extensive experience in pulmonary vascular conditions and obstructive lung disease.
His career includes numerous honors, including resident of the month and multiple academic distinctions during his medical training. Fluent in English, Nepali and Hindi, he is committed to serving a diverse patient population. His practice philosophy centers on involving patients in care decisions and striving for the highest standard of medical excellence.
“I believe in empowering patients to take an active role in their health care decisions,” says Dr. Nepal. “My goal is to deliver compassionate, evidence-based care that meets the unique needs of each patient.”
Dr. Nepal earned his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Surgery from Tribhuvan University, Maharajgunj Medical Campus in Nepal, followed by a year-long rotatory internship. He continued his medical training in the United States, completing his residency in internal medicine at Woodhull Medical and Mental Health Center, in Brooklyn, New York, where he later served as chief resident. He then completed a fellowship in pulmonary and critical care medicine at the University of Kentucky, in Lexington, Kentucky.
